Title of article :
A probabilistic approach to setting distance relays in transmission networks

Abstract :
The setting of back up zones in distance relays has to deal
with fault current infeeds between the relay and remote faults.
Traditional approaches to this problem are conservative, some
times leaving portions of a Power System without sensitive or
selective back up protection.
In this paper a probabilistic model for the relay errors resulting
from the variation of the infeeds is developed. Other
measurement inaccuracies are also considered in order to
build a probabilistic approach to setting all zones of distance
relays.
The developed concepts are associated to automatic tools for
computer aided protection coordination and applied to the
Portuguese Transmission grid.
